I would not mind seeing the deal with the Browns which would land us the #38 and #71 picks. That would be sweet. We would end up with four selections in the 2nd and 3rd rounds with two low picks in each of those rounds. Positioning to get two low picks in round two and three would be awesome based on the talent and key if they want to trade out.

Looking at the boards there is round two talent still standing by the time we picked at #71 and that to me is where the value in trading our first round pick would come. That and the fact there is plenty of talent to choose from at #38 as well.

Ted could parlay this scenario into a killer draft.
